    thatgirl said:
    Sceptile (Oren)
    Nature: Impish
    Held Item: Leftovers
    Moves: Leaf Blade, Focus Punch, Substitute, Thunderpunch

    Earthquake is wasted on Sceptile. Trying to damage Fire types are you? Don't even bother, besides, you have Ninetales's Flash Fire to take care of Fire attacks. Ideally, you'll want one of Sceptile's best moves - Leech Seed - to form an awesome combination with Substitute. However, Leech Seed is only available as a bred-on move and I'm sure you don't want to start over with a new Sceptile. :(
    For that last slot, give it Thunderpunch which takes care of Flying-types. And replace Earthquake with Focus Punch as it's effective against common special walls like Blissey and Snorlax.


    Ninetails (Nuria)
    Nature: Bashful
    Held Item: Charcoal
    Moves: Flamethrower, Confuse Ray, Will-o-wisp, Grudge

    No one seems to realize that Ninetales's best move is Grudge, which totally eliminates the PP of the last move your opponent used on you if that move faints you. So opponents can say goodbye to their precious Earthquakes and Surfs if they plan on using it against Ninetales.
    Safeguard is all right, but Will-o-wisp would be a better choice against physical attackers.
    Replace the useless Charcoal with another Leftovers. You can buy more Leftovers in the Battle Frontier.


    Whiscash (Hugh)
    Nature: Adamant
    Held Item: None
    Moves: Amnesia, Earthquake, Ice Beam, Return

    Hate to break it to you, but as a Water type, Whiscash sucks. Of the three Water/Ground types, Swampert is the best, Quagsire is second only due to its Water Absorb trait, and poor little Whiscash just doesn't cut it.
    This is a good oppurtunity to find another better Water Pokemon. You have Milotic if you're willing to look hard for Feebas, Starmie who is a great Pokemon, Ludicolo if you don't mind another Grass type, Kingdra for a Rain Dancing sweeper, and even Walrein and Tentacruel are underrated options.

    Let's see, 3 other Pokemon…

    A special wall is always appreciated. Snorlax is awesome and fits on just about any team, provided you have access to FR/LG. If you don't, you can opt for Regice.

    A physical sweeper would be good. You have a lot of choices here: Salamence, Heracross, Flygon, Rhydon, Dodrio, Metagross, Slaking, etc.

    Your last Pokemon can be a physical wall (Skarmory, Donphan, Weezing), a second physical sweeper (choose one from above), or just another Pokemon that does not add to the weaknesses that the rest of your Pokemon have.
